What companies run services between Saxen, Austria and Grein, Austria?
ÖBB operates a train from Saxen to Grein-Bad Kreuzen hourly. Tickets cost €1–3 and the journey takes 9 min. Alternatively, Oberösterreichischer Verkehrsverbund operates a bus from Saxen B3/Abzw Bahnhof to Grein Schiffstation 4 times a day. Tickets cost €3–5 and the journey takes 10 min.
